Virgin Active Health Clubs open latest location at Sydney's Bondi Junction

Virgin Active Health Clubs has opened its latest club with a new eight-level facility at Bondi Junction in Sydney's Eastern Suburbs.

With a smaller footprint compared to when the group first launched in Australia, in Sydney's Frenchs Forest in late 2008, the new club offers purpose-built studios for cycle, boxing, Reformer Pilates, yoga and HIIT, plus a gym with a strength, cardio and outdoor functional training zone.

On its website the facility advises "with world-class coaches, the best training equipment from across the globe, premium post-workout amenities including  … hairdryers, (hair) straighteners and Apelles products, as well as the ability to book your spot in advance and choose your Reformer bed, Yoga mat, Boxing bag and bike, Virgin Active Bondi Junction will be the experience your workout deserves."

Prior to its opening on Monday 9th December, the new location received a high profile launch last month when Virgin Group and Virgin Active founder Sir Richard Branson staged a media event at Sydney's Bondi Beach.

Speaking at the launch, Sir Richard stated "I absolutely love spending time in Australia and I'm very excited to be here to celebrate the launch of our newest Virgin Active club."
